Its debut for the indie label, produced by former Blink-182 member Mark Hoppus, is due next spring.
The Florida-reared group signed to Drive-Thru in 2000, but found its biggest success after parent label MCA took over with 2002's "Sticks & Stones," which has sold more than 863,000 copies in the United States, according to Nielsen SoundScan. - more on this story
